BELLINGHAM, Wash. — A one car fatality crash shut down the offramp to the Bellisfair Mall in Whatcom county for several hours overnight Tuesday.
According to Washington State Patrol, a driver in his 20s was killed when he failed to negotiate a curve in the road and crashed his vehicle into a concrete traffic light at the end of the offramp around 12:30 a.m.
There were no other cars involved in the crash and the man was the only occupant in the vehicle.
A detour was set up at exit 256A for drivers as officers remained at the scene to investigate.
Troopers say the man was wearing his seatbelt but alcohol is a possible factor in the crash.
